THE ANALYSIS

Airmeet's workforce strategy from 2020 to 2026, as indicated by recent operational adjustments, reveals a pronounced trend of contraction and strategic realignment rather than expansion. The company implemented significant workforce reductions in May 2023, shedding 75 employees to bolster its cash runway, enhance operational efficiency amidst a discernible business slowdown, and address instances where execution did not yield desired outcomes. This action closely followed an earlier reduction of 30 personnel in the same month, which was explicitly framed as part of a major restructuring initiative. Notably, this marked the third such restructuring within a 16-month period, underscoring a sustained and aggressive effort to reduce operational costs and strategically pivot the organization towards the development of AI-powered features. The cumulative impact of these decisions signals a decisive shift towards a leaner operational model, prioritizing financial stability and a focused technological direction in response to evolving market pressures and internal performance metrics. This strategic reorientation of human capital deployment, with a clear emphasis on AI integration, suggests a fundamental recalibration of the company's long-term operational and product development priorities.
